Financial Performance Highlights
For the financial year ended March 31, 2026, the company achieved a robust standalone net profit of ₹3,194.30 crore, compared to ₹1,450.94 crore in the previous year. Total revenue for the year reached ₹13,837.80 crore, more than doubling from the ₹6,775.21 crore reported in the prior fiscal year. The quarter ending March 31, 2026, specifically, saw a net profit of ₹1,065.59 crore, underscoring strong performance in the mining and steel divisions.
Strategic Acquisitions and Capital Expansion
The Board of Directors has approved significant strategic growth initiatives. This includes the acquisition of an equity stake in an entity in Papua New Guinea by the wholly-owned subsidiary, Lloyds Global Resources FZCO. This move is designed to support long-term cooperation and mining agreements at the Panguna Mine. Furthermore, the company has secured an enabling approval for the issuance of non-convertible debentures up to ₹2,500 crore in one or more tranches, alongside an immediate approved issuance of ₹700 crore on a private placement basis.
Dividend and Governance Updates
Reflecting the company’s strong financial health and commitment to shareholder returns, the Board has recommended a 100% final dividend, amounting to ₹1 per share on equity shares of face value ₹1, subject to approval at the upcoming Annual General Meeting. Additionally, the company has bolstered its leadership governance with the re-appointment of Independent Directors Mr. Ramesh Luharuka and Ms. Seema Saini for second terms, ensuring continuity in corporate oversight and strategic decision-making.
